#### 35 Supply of any goods or services to authorised officers
(1) The owner of prescribed premises, or an employee or agent of such a person, shall not supply any goods or services to a person whom the owner, employee or agent, as the case may be, knows is an authorized officer.
Penalty: Imprisonment for 12 months.
(1AA) Subsection (1) does not apply to conduct that is approved in writing by the Secretary.
> Note: The defendant bears an evidential burden in relation to the matter in subsection (1AA). See subsection 13.3(3) of the Criminal Code.
(1A) An authorised officer must not receive any goods or services supplied to him or her by the owner of prescribed premises, or an employee or agent of such a person.
Penalty: Imprisonment for 12 months.
(1B) Subsection (1A) does not apply if the supply of the goods or services has been approved in writing by the Secretary under subsection (1AA).
> Note: The defendant bears an evidential burden in relation to the matter in subsection (1B). See subsection 13.3(3) of the Criminal Code.
(2) An offence against this section is punishable on summary conviction.
